what your saying is normal, 98% of the time in any standard car will do that.. reverse has no synchros, so by putting it in first you stopping all the gears inside moving, then it will slip into reverse easy... or hold it against the gate in reverse, and let the clutch out slightly..
Originally Posted by evo_rc
i think its normal....mine does that every morning ,... what i do i just hold the clutch down and shift to 1st gear while still holdin down the clutch. After that it shifts smoothly in reverse......
